Explain the effect of the recent economic collapse on families

What will be an ideal response?


Families, and especially children, have borne a disproportionate burden of the recent economic failures. After tremendous strides in family economic well-being throughout the 1990s, the 2000s have seen a steady decline. Additionally, the number of children living below the poverty line has risen throughout the decade and is projected to continue to rise. Minority families and female-only households have been the hardest hit.
